They are hiring but the interview process at pretty much all Asian carriers has a high failure rate and the training failure rate is not much better either. Mixed opinions about KAL overall, it is a good gig if you go there as a captain but I wouldn't go there as an F/O and the social working environment according to a couple of friends that are there (granted on the 73) is not very inclusive, they won't socialize with you very much or hardly at all. I would recommend that you take a look at NCA (Nippon Cargo Airlines) I'm good friends and know many of their pilots and they are all very happy there but KAL if you come in as a captain like I said and you fulfill your social agenda outside the company is a pretty good gig too.
